:root {
  --primary: #5a82b6;
  --primary-text: #000000;
  --secondary: #46c279;
  --secondary-text: #ffffff;
  --accent: #000000;
  --accent-text: #ffffff;
}

#main-container{
  background-color: rgb(0, 0, 0);
  margin: 0 auto;
  padding: 0;
  align-content: center;
}

*{
  margin: 0;
  padding: 0;
  width: 100%;
  border: solid 1px #000;
}

/* color y tamano */

#main-container main h1 {
  padding-top: 20px;
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
  font-size: 5rem;
  font-weight: 400;
    background: orange;
    background: -webkit-gradient(linear,left top,right top,from(orange),to(red
    ));
    background: -webkit-linear-gradient(left,orange,red);
    background: linear-gradient(
90deg
,orange,red);
    background-clip: text;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

#main-container main p{
  padding-top: 10px;
  color:white;
  font-size: 30px;
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
}

/* cajas guia 

.main_box{
  border: solid 5px #000;
  display: inline-block;
  vertical-align: middle;
}

.text{
  border: solid 1px #000;
  display: inline-block;
  vertical-align: middle;
}

.images{
  border: solid 1px #000;
  display: inline-block;
  vertical-align: middle;
}

*/

/* contenido */

.main_box{
  margin: 0 auto;
  width: 100%;
  align-items: center;
}

.text {
  padding: 0;
  align-items: center;
  text-align: center;
  width: 100%;
}

#image_zombie{
  margin: 0 auto;
  width: 30%;
  align-content: center;
}

#logo_opensea {
  margin: 0 auto;
  width: 180px;
  align-content: center;
  padding-top: 35px;
}

#Comunity{
  margin: 0 auto;
  padding: 0;
  text-align: center;
  width: 100%;
  padding-bottom: 2%;
}

#social_media{
  margin: 0 auto;
  padding: 0;
  width: 150px;
  display: flex;
  flex-direction: row;
  padding-bottom: 20px;
}

.logo1{
  margin-right: 10px;
}

.logo2{
  margin-right: 10px;
}

.logo3{
  margin-right: 10px;
}

/*
.discord{
  margin: 0 auto;
  width: 10%;
  align-content: center;
}

.twitter{
  margin: 0 auto;
  width: 10%;
  align-content: center;
}

.instagram{
  margin: 0 auto;
  width: 13%;
  align-content: center;
} 
*/

/* Parte 2 "Beneficios" */

#Beneficios{
  background-image: url(images/glow.png);
  background-repeat: no-repeat;
  background-position: 650px 0;
  background-size: 800px;
  background-color: rgb(255, 255, 255);
  margin: 0 auto;
  padding: 50px;
  align-content: center;
  color:black;
  font-size: 30px;
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;

}

#Beneficios h2 {
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
  font-size: 5rem;
  font-weight: 400;
    background: rgb(9, 255, 0);
    background: -webkit-gradient(linear,left top,right top,from(rgb(0, 255, 13)),to(rgb(0, 0, 255)
    ));
    background: -webkit-linear-gradient(left,rgb(0, 255, 0),rgb(4, 0, 255));
    background: linear-gradient(
90deg
,rgb(0, 255, 34),rgb(0, 4, 255));
    background-clip: text;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

.b_iniciales p{
  padding-top: 5px;
}

#image_zombie_banner{
  width: 100%;
  padding-bottom: 60px;
}

/* Parte 3 "Roadmap" */

#Roadmap{
  background-image: url(images/line_glow1.png);
  background-repeat: no-repeat;
  background-position: 0 -200px;
  background-size: 100% 100%;

  background-color: rgb(0, 0, 0);
  margin: 0 auto;
  padding: 50px;
  align-content: center;
  color:white;
  font-size: 30px;
  text-align: center;
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
}

#Roadmap h3 {
  padding: 10px;
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
  font-size: 5rem;
  font-weight: 400;
    background: rgb(4, 0, 255);
    background: -webkit-gradient(linear,left top,right top,from(rgb(38, 0, 255)),to(rgb(208, 255, 0)
    ));
    background: -webkit-linear-gradient(left,rgb(0, 4, 255),rgb(255, 247, 0));
    background: linear-gradient(
90deg
,rgb(0, 102, 255),rgb(255, 255, 0));
    background-clip: text;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

.stage1 p {
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
  font-size: 35px;
  font-weight: 400;
    background: rgb(255, 255, 255);
    background: -webkit-gradient(linear,left top,right top,from(rgb(255, 255, 255)),to(rgb(255, 255, 255)
    ));
    background: -webkit-linear-gradient(left,rgb(255, 255, 255),rgb(255, 255, 255));
    background: linear-gradient(
90deg
,rgb(255, 255, 255),rgb(255, 77, 0));
    background-clip: text;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

.stage2 p {
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
  font-size: 35px;
  font-weight: 400;
    background: rgb(255, 255, 255);
    background: -webkit-gradient(linear,left top,right top,from(rgb(255, 255, 255)),to(rgb(255, 255, 255)
    ));
    background: -webkit-linear-gradient(left,rgb(255, 255, 255),rgb(245, 245, 245));
    background: linear-gradient(
90deg
,rgb(255, 255, 255),rgb(255, 234, 0));
    background-clip: text;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

.stage3 p {
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
  font-size: 35px;
  font-weight: 400;
    background: rgb(255, 255, 255);
    background: -webkit-gradient(linear,left top,right top,from(rgb(255, 255, 255)),to(rgb(255, 255, 255)
    ));
    background: -webkit-linear-gradient(left,rgb(255, 255, 255),rgb(245, 245, 245));
    background: linear-gradient(
90deg
,rgb(255, 255, 255),rgb(85, 255, 0));
    background-clip: text;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

.stage4 p {
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
  font-size: 35px;
  font-weight: 400;
    background: rgb(255, 255, 255);
    background: -webkit-gradient(linear,left top,right top,from(rgb(255, 255, 255)),to(rgb(255, 255, 255)
    ));
    background: -webkit-linear-gradient(left,rgb(255, 255, 255),rgb(245, 245, 245));
    background: linear-gradient(
90deg
,rgb(255, 255, 255),rgb(0, 255, 208));
    background-clip: text;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

.stage5 p {
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
  font-size: 35px;
  font-weight: 400;
    background: rgb(255, 255, 255);
    background: -webkit-gradient(linear,left top,right top,from(rgb(255, 255, 255)),to(rgb(255, 255, 255)
    ));
    background: -webkit-linear-gradient(left,rgb(255, 255, 255),rgb(245, 245, 245));
    background: linear-gradient(
90deg
,rgb(255, 255, 255),rgb(0, 21, 255));
    background-clip: text;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

.stage6 p {
  font-family:Impact, Haettenschweiler, 'Arial Narrow Bold', sans-serif;
  font-size: 35px;
  font-weight: 400;
    background: rgb(255, 255, 255);
    background: -webkit-gradient(linear,left top,right top,from(rgb(255, 255, 255)),to(rgb(255, 255, 255)
    ));
    background: -webkit-linear-gradient(left,rgb(255, 255, 255),rgb(245, 245, 245));
    background: linear-gradient(
90deg
,rgb(255, 255, 255),rgb(170, 0, 255));
    background-clip: text;
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
}

/* Detalles finales */

#mini_game{
  margin: 0 auto;
  width: 80%;
  align-content: center;
}